Bae Jin-yeong (Hangul: ???; born February 19, 1993),[1] better known by her stage
name Punch (Hangul: ??), is a South Korean singer signed under Naym Naym
Entertainment. She is best known for her original soundtracks for various TV
series, notably "Sleepless Night" for It's Okay, That's Love (2014), "Everytime"
for Descendants of the Sun (2016) and "Stay with Me" for Guardian: The Lonely and
Great God (2016).[2]
